did you get coaxial speakers? you're supposed to get component speakers, a set of 2 woofers, 2 tweeters, and 2 crossovers.. i was just wondering what you did/planned to do, i dont know if anything bad can result from using coaxials and tweeters up front, as long as you have crossovers, deinitely have crossovers, you dont want the full range of signals goin to your new tweeters, it just might end up being more expensive in the end instead of buying a set, oh and you'll have to run new wiring to the tweeters, have fun, sorry for rambling lol

I mounted 1" alpine tweeters, I have the 6.5" type r component system. I remember exactly what i did now, there was a metal bracket that went across the bottom of the stock tweeter, two screws held it onto the bottom of the plastic/fabric part that sits in the dash, and one screw goes into the center of the bottom of the tweeter. the holes for the 2 screws outside the tweeter had to be shortened, I just used pliers to break half of the holes away, then used longer screws becasue the original ones werent long enough, the tweeter was deeper so it moves the bracket a bit further away from the plastic grille part. the screw holes had to be cut because the tweeter was too wide to fit in between them, and the screw in the center of the stock tweeter with the bracket fit into the hole on the bottom of the alpine tweeter, I'll take some pics in a little bit for you, hope that helped.
